The average salary for QA Intern is $87,162 per year or $42 per hour, with top earners making up to $145,950 (90th percentile). Typically, pay ranges from $66,824 (25th percentile) to $114,695 (75th percentile) annually. Salary estimates are based on 148 salaries submitted anonymously to Glassdoor by QA Intern employees.
